Hello. I'm really don't understand, why jou cutting roots, to make another roots. 🤔 Original roots are in bad condition or why you doing this? Thank you for answer.
@bonsaipark Жыл бұрын
thanks for your questions. The number one purpose is to make the roots come out in all directions. The roots that emerge first tend to grow straight, so it is difficult to maintain good rooting. The rest is to make a tree as short as possible.

Hi, how many days after sowing do you cut the roots? Thank you in advance.
@bonsaipark Жыл бұрын
Thank you for your comment. I think it takes about a month, but as a guide, I think it's good when the buds in the center start to move and the stems are a little reddish.
